It involves a lot more then just seeing. If you have played MMOs for a long time, you would know that bots are taken seriously and that they have certain protocols in dealing with them.

In some MMOs, they prefer to figure out what bot program is being used and what part of the system was vulnerable to it. You can block out the program and patch up the hole so future programs can not abuse the same problem. They are aiming at the root of the problem.

You can ban all the bots you want but they will just return. You block out the bot program and fortify the part of the system that was vulnerable to hacking and you deal a much bigger blow.

Players need to understand, the war against bots, is an endless war. Once you block out a program, a new one is simply developed. It repeats, over and over.

On top of bots, GMs also have countless numbers of tickets from all other aspects of the game as well.
